Princeton's WordNet

  1. saber rattling, sabre rattlingnoun

    the ostentatious display of military power (with the implied threat that it might be used)

  1. saber rattling

    Saber rattling is a term used to refer to the act of displaying military strength or making aggressive threats, typically by a nation, to intimidate or deter perceived enemies. It is often considered a political method used to seek negotiation advantages, discourage hostility, or simply to demonstrate power. The term comes from the idea of a soldier rattling or brandishing their sword (saber) as a show of force.

Examples of saber rattling in a Sentence

  1. Foreign Minister Frank-Walter Steinmeier:

    What we shouldn't do now is to inflame the situation by loud saber-rattling and shrill war cries, whoever believes that symbolic tank parades on the alliance's eastern border will bring more security is mistaken.

  2. Ryan Castilloux:

    No question it's saber rattling, i think China would be reluctant to cut off supplies to anyone just yet, but the optics are designed to send a clear message – we know your vulnerabilities.

  3. Yun Sun:

    The Chinese tried to to use saber rattling and use the rhetorical war in order to deter Pelosi's trip, and they went overboard with their threats, now Pelosi decided to have the trip and that leaves the Chinese hanging, because they can't really deliver.
